Why Arizona Exterior Paint Is Different

UV

exposure

Intense Sun

Product and color selection should account for prolonged ultraviolet exposure.

HEAT

cycling

Temperature Swings

Expansion and contraction can expose weak preparation and substrate movement.

PREP

first

Surface Condition

Cleaning, repairs, adhesion, and compatible primer affect coating performance.

RAIN

seasonal

Moisture

Moisture sources and drying conditions must be evaluated before coating.

Our Exterior Process

Built to Last

Power Wash

All dirt, mildew, and chalking removed. Surfaces dry 24–48 hours before anything is applied.

Stucco Repair

All cracks, chips, and damaged areas repaired with elastomeric stucco patch. No skipped steps.

Exterior Primer

Correct primer applied based on surface type and condition. Critical for adhesion in Arizona heat.

2 Coats Evershield

Dunn Edwards Evershield applied in two full coats. UV-rated, elastomeric, and monsoon-resistant.

Exterior Product Option

Dunn Edwards

Dunn Edwards was founded in Los Angeles in 1925 and has spent nearly a century mastering paint for the Southwest. Their Evershield elastomeric exterior is specifically engineered for extreme UV, thermal shock, and desert moisture conditions.
